Fresno, Calif. – One person was injured when a vehicle struck a scooter rider in Fresno on Wednesday afternoon, according to the Fresno Police Department.
The accident took place in the area of Clovis and Kings Canyon avenues shortly before 3 p.m.
Police said a man on a mobility scooter was trying to cross Clovis Avenue when he was hit by a southbound vehicle.
The scooter rider sustained lower extremities injuries and was taken to a hospital for treatment.
The injuries to the rider were non-life-threatening, police said.
It's unclear whether alcohol or drugs played a role in the crash.
Police are investigating to determine the cause of the collision.

If a pedestrian accident is caused by a driver's negligence, the victim or their next of kin may seek compensation from the driver or their insurance company.
A pedestrian may also be held liable in case the crash was caused by the pedestrian's actions. However, it is important to note that California is a comparative fault state, meaning if the pedestrian was partially at fault, they may still have a chance to recover damages from the at-fault driver.
